MLB this Week: Post All-Star Break

by Matt Smith

CovMLBUK2014After the All-Star week lull we’re right back into the MLB regular season action this working week with live games available to watch during the British evening on Wednesday, Thursday and Friday.

Arguably the most intriguing series this week takes place in Milwaukee where the Brewers host NL Central rivals the Cincinnati Reds. The third and final game of the series is a day-game on Wednesday and on the current schedule would see Mike Leake and Kyle Lohse toeing the rubber. The game will be shown in the UK on BT Sport 1.

Elsewhere, Trevor Bauer has seemed to settle in well to life with the Indians and he should start on Wednesday against Kyle Gibson and the Twins, whilst Stephen Strasburg starts for the Nationals against the Rockies and Bartolo Colon gets a start in Seattle in an interleague match-up that sadly denies us the always funny sight of watching him in the batter’s box.

On Thursday, the Blue Jays’ exciting young pitcher Marcus Stroman takes on the Red Sox, with Tim Hudson and Cole Hamels lining up for what should be a strong pitching match-up in Philadelphia (provided Hamels hasn’t been traded by then, of course) and Jeff Samardzija should make his fourth start for the A’s after his recent trade from the Cubs.

The Cubs are in action at Wrigley Field in the lone early game on Friday, taking on the St. Louis Cardinals.
